Application of Variable Switching Frequency PWM Control with Power Loss Prediction in Surfaced-mounted Permanent Magnet Synchronous Motor

Abstract

This paper adopted the variable switching frequency PWM (VSFPWM) control to the SPMSM and combined the VSFPWM with SVPWM and DPWM. A power loss model was built to quantitatively compare the system efficiency at CSF/VSF SVPWM and CSF/VSF DPWM. Simulation and experimental validations were pursued on a 5kW surfaced-mounted permanent synchronous motor (SPMSM) drive system.
